4(1H)-Quinolinone,8-fluoro-6-methoxy-

Description:
4(1H)-Quinolinone, 8-fluoro-6-methoxy- is a chemical compound characterized by its quinolinone structure, which features a bicyclic system composed of a benzene ring fused to a pyridine ring. This specific compound includes a fluoro substituent at the 8-position and a methoxy group at the 6-position of the quinolinone framework. The presence of these functional groups can influence its chemical reactivity, solubility, and biological activity. Typically, quinolinones are known for their diverse pharmacological properties, including antibacterial, antiviral, and anticancer activities. The fluorine atom may enhance lipophilicity and metabolic stability, while the methoxy group can affect the compound's electronic properties and steric hindrance. The compound's molecular structure contributes to its potential applications in medicinal chemistry and drug development. As with many organic compounds, its behavior in various environments, such as solvents or biological systems, can vary significantly based on its substituents and overall molecular configuration.
Formula:C10H8FNO2
